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5132055 7204405 0945894969 839984 941640
26858957 45 1480
26858957 45 1480
0640 9959927 263851 08
All about undefined
Interested in learning more?
26858957 45 1480
0640 9959927 263851 08
See more
1061243 308304888 3424168
0055993576 05 7519 980328
See more
2841367 478097283 1901
836357 593962934 44624115
See more